Mathrans, a textile firm, wants to hire two costume designers for a new movie project. To precisely determine the future job per

formance of the job applicants, the company makes them take a test that assesses their sense of color and design, expertise in distressing techniques and fabric qualities, skills in machining and bead work, and knowledge of millinery and wig work. This scenario best illustrates the process of:
Business
1 answer:
irga5000 [103]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

<u>Validation</u>

Explanation:

The validation process occurs when an organization needs to know the skills and performances of some job seekers. Through a test with selected measures, such as construction measures, content and criteria, it is possible for the company to know and predict if a candidate is able to perform the tasks assigned to the position he is running.

Sanborn Industries has the following overhead costs and cost drivers. Direct labor hours are estimated at 100,000 for the year.
Nana76 [90]

Answer:

d) 34.17

Explanation:

we must first calculate the total overhead expenses = $120,000 (ordering and receiving) + $297,000 (machine setup) + $1,500,000 (machining) + $1,200,000 (assembly parts) + $300,000 (inspection) = $3,417,000

since overhead is applied based on direct labor hours, then the predetermined overhead rate = total overhead expenses / total direct labor hours = $3,417,000 / 100,000 labor hours = $34.17 per labor hour
